The paytable in Bulldozer slot is a neat showcase of farmyard charm. For the low-paying symbols, the classic 10, J, Q, K, and A get a farm-fresh makeover, turning up frequently to offer small but regular returns. Things get a little more interesting with the mid-tier icons—bale of hay, a clucking hen, and a wide-eyed lamb amp up the rewards as you move up through the symbol ladder. Each fits the theme well and gives every spin a splash of rustic character.
High-paying symbols begin with the cheerful farmer, but the game’s namesake, the bulldozer, is the one you’ll want to see lined up the most, just behind the game’s wild symbol. Five bulldozers across a payline is a strong win, but nothing quite compares to the wild symbol. Land five wilds and you hit the slot’s highest payout—600x your stake—making these wilds the true prize. Wild symbols substitute for all regular icons and add the chance for some impressive line wins, especially when they combine with other high symbols.
Special symbols drive the game’s real excitement: scatters and coins. Scatters are the gateway to free spins, while golden coins open up bonus opportunities, both of which extend the action well beyond what’s available on the main reels.
Bulldozer’s strongest features come from its free spins and innovative Hold and Spin mode. Wilds are rarely boring here—when a bull wild and bulldozer icon appear on the same spin, they interact in a neat way, with the bull charging toward the bulldozer and spreading wilds vertically or horizontally as it goes. The result: extra wilds paving fresh possibilities across the board, a nice showcase of slot design meeting theme.
The free spins round is where the gameplay really wakes up. Getting three, four, or five scatter symbols launches you straight into 10, 20, or even 30 free spins respectively. During these rounds, two new coin symbols come into play: the “W coin,” which acts as a wild and throws in a surprise multiplier (flipping over to reveal how much it boosts line wins), and the “+1FS coin,” rewarding an extra free spin when it lands. Multiplier wins can make a huge difference in this phase, breaking up the steady base game pacing with shots of bigger potential.
Fans of hold-and-respin mechanics will enjoy the Hold and Spin bonus. When five or more coin symbols land, the feature locks those coins into place and grants three respins; each new coin that drops in resets the spin count to three. The bonus stays alive as long as fresh coins continue to land, and this is also where the game’s jackpot coins—mini, minor, major, and mega—can show up. Each jackpot coin awards a prize shown above the reels. There’s no progressive jackpot here, but this bonus offers adrenaline for those who like extended, suspenseful spins.
For players who don’t want to wait for the right combination, Bulldozer allows the option to buy into the free spins feature directly—an appealing shortcut for those who want to dive straight into the action.
Bulldozer makes getting started surprisingly easy, even for those new to 1X2 Gaming slots. Bets are set by clicking the coin pile icon on the far right of the screen, with all lines locked in place to keep things straightforward—no fiddling with paylines required. The betting range covers most preferences, starting as low as 0.20 and climbing up to 50 per spin, making it accessible for casual players and high rollers alike.
The main control bar is intuitive: you’ll find sound and rules toggles to the left, so silencing that persistent banjo is a breeze if the country twang wears thin. The trophy icon opens the paytable, providing a quick look at all prizes and features. Over to the right is the auto spin button, which lets the game run on its own until stopped—though there’s no option to fine-tune auto spins. Turbo-spinning isn’t here, but spins move at a brisk, modern pace.
A prominent star coin icon in the upper corner gives access to feature buy options if you want immediate entrance to the free spins bonus.
